> You have to move the form logic in its own action
>
> def myform():
>        form = SQLFORM(....).process()
>        if form.accepted: form = 'Done!'
>        return form
>
> Then do
>
> <button class="btn btn-primary" data-toggle="collapse"
> data-target="#create-group">
>         Create new group <span class="caret"></span>
> </button>
> <div id="create-group" class="collapse">
>         <div class="alert alert-block alert-info fade in">
>                 <button class="alert close" data-toggle="collapse"
> data-target="#create-group">
>                         &times;
>                 </button>
>                 {{=LOAD('default','myform', ajax=True)}}
>         </div>
> </div>
